Formulation Notes

ChondroCare is designed to provide broad support for healthy joints by featuring high quality glucosamine sulfate and chondroitin sulfate, nutritional factors known to help support cartilage health and soft tissue formation. This well-rounded formula also features methylsulfonylmethane for joint health as well as zinc, copper, manganese, and selenium for antioxidant support.

This product is non-GMO and gluten-free.
